公路边坡病害特征分析和处治方案  

Characteristic Analysis and Treatment Scheme of Highway Slope Diseases

摘  要:为了保证公路边坡在运营期间的安全性,减少安全事故,分析了公路边坡病害的排查程序和排查重点,以云湛高速公路沿线的上边坡和下路堤为研究对象,对沿线的边坡病害开展详细调查,发现边坡存在落石、崩塌、滑坡、坡面冲沟等病害。同时,分析了边坡病害的时空分布特征和病害特征。对于落石、崩塌病害,选用SNS主动防护网和护面墙进行防护。对于边坡坡面冲沟病害,选用M7.5浆砌片石进行防护;对于滑坡病害,其对公路运营安全影响最大,提出用预应力锚索框架梁进行处治,并建立计算模型,计算了边坡在不同预应力锚索布置间距下的稳定系数,发现锚索布置间距为2.0 m时边坡稳定系数最大,加固效果最佳,这说明预应力锚索加固滑坡方案是可行的。In order to ensure the safety of highway slopes during operation and reduce safety accidents,the investigation procedures and key points of highway slope diseases were analyzed.Taking the upper slope and lower embankment along the Yunzhan Expressway as the research objects,a detailed investigation was conducted on the slope diseases along the line,and it was found that there were rockfall,collapse,landslide,slope gully and other diseases on the slopes.At the same time,the spatiotemporal distribution characteristics and disease features of slope diseases were analyzed.For rockfall and collapse diseases,SNS active protective nets and protective walls have been choosed for protection.M7.5 mortar rubble is choosed for the protection of slope and gully diseases;For landslide diseases,which have the greatest impact on highway operation safety,it is proposed to use prestressed anchor cable frame beams for treatment,and a calculation model is established to calculate the stability coefficient of the slope under different spacing of prestressed anchor cables.It is found that the slope stability coefficient is the highest and the reinforcement effect is the best when the spacing of anchor cables is 2.0 m.This indicates that the prestressed anchor cable reinforcement scheme for landslides is feasible.
